Decade path · College Scorecard
Net-price paths do not share a shape
NET-SPLIT · 2013–2023
One school has a directional average-net-price path over 2013–2023; the other sits in a measured range (or the two move opposite ways). Cost gaps on this board are moving targets.
- University of Central Oklahoma: average net price rose +69.1% from $11,232 (2013) to $18,990 (2023), r² 0.94.
- University of Minnesota-Twin Cities: net price ranged $16,318–$17,878 across 11 years (2013–2023); endpoint change -0.4% is not a trend (r² 0.02).
- University of Central Oklahoma: acceptance-rate path 2013–2023 stays non-directional here (r² 0.04).
- University of Minnesota-Twin Cities: acceptance rate eased +73.4% across 2013–2023 (r² 0.90).
College Scorecard institution series; dollars are nominal. Direction claims require r² ≥ 0.40 on the fitted annual slope, otherwise the page reports the observed range. Descriptive history, not a recommendation.

| Metric | University of Central Oklahoma Edmond, OK | University of Minnesota-Twin Cities Minneapolis, MN |
| Location | Edmond, OK | Minneapolis, MN |
| Undergraduate Enrollment | 10,170 | 31,855 |
| 150%-Time Completion | 37.1% | 85.0% |
| In-State Tuition | $8,818 | $17,214 |
| Out-of-State Tuition | $19,704 | $38,362 |
| Median Earnings (10 yr) | $48,351 | $69,020 |
| Retention Rate | 65.2% | 91.1% |
| Median Earnings (6 yr) | $43,074 | $57,984 |
| SAT Average | 1,090 | 1,362 |
| Loan Repayment Rate (Completers) | 69.7% | 81.9% |
Rows ordered by relative gap on this pair. Teal = better side. College Scorecard.
